What Is the Ka'aba in Mecca? - Learn Religions
Feb 1, 2019 · When Muslims complete the Hajj pilgrimage to Makkah (Mecca), the ritual includes circling the Ka'aba. The Ka'aba is a semi-cubic building that stands about 15 meters (49 feet) high and 10-12 meters (33 to 39 feet) wide. It is an ancient, simple structure made of granite.

10 things you need to know about the Ka'bah | IslamicFinder
Aug 10, 2017 · Following are the 10 things about the Ka’bah that we need to know about: 1. Two Doors and a window. The Ka’bah used to have a pair of doors: one for entry and the other for exit. In addition, it also used to have a window – signs of which are no longer visible. The Ka’bah currently has only one door. 2. Built and rebuilt.
